3rd Iberoamerican Symposium Brewing and Filling Technology 2012 in Brazil
Event Venue
Petropolis (Rio de Janeiro), Brazil
Event Date
18. Jun 2012 - 21. Jun 2012
Languanges: English | Espanõl | Português
Including the 6th Symposium for Barley, Malt and Malting of SENAI
Symposium for managers from production, filling and quality assurance of breweries and soft drink producers in the Spanish- and Portuguese-speaking world.
With accompanying exhibition
